How to Buy Clothes Online From the UK

The UK offers a variety of fashion brands, ranging from fashionable womenswear to elegant male clothing. Selfridges, Harrods and other famous department stores are also located in the UK.

However, purchasing clothes from UK retailers can be difficult for those who aren't from the country. Many shops have restrictions on shipping that make it difficult to buy their clothing internationally.

Matalan is an omni-channel retailer that offers quality and value for the entire family. With 230 UK stores and 49 International franchises across Europe and the Middle East and Africa, their products include children's, women's and men's clothing as furniture and homeware. Their stores are open late openings, easy parking and an option to collect and click. The brand also has a wide range of styles to suit any wardrobe, from casual basics to fashion-forward pieces.

Another option for buying clothes is John Lewis A huge department store that is known around the world for its high-quality clothing from brands such as Whistles, Joules and Barbour and a wide range of items like electronics, beauty and baby formula. Although the store does offer some international shipping options you should be aware that their 'Never Knowingly Oversold price guarantee is only applicable to UK orders, not internationally.

Marks and Spencer, known in the lingo as M&S or Marks and Sparks, is a British retailer that sells clothing and food products. The company employs over 35,000 employees and operates more than a thousand stores across the world. It is a major player in the retail sector and has its headquarters in City of London, UK.

Another great way to shop online for clothes is to use a parcel forwarding company such as Forward2me. These companies provide you with the UK shipping address and can take your orders from different websites and then deliver them to you in one package. This is a great solution if you're an expat or want to avoid the shipping restrictions of many websites based in the UK.

If you're looking to buy clothes in the UK however, you don't live there you can make use of a service like Jetkrate. This will provide you with a unique UK address that you can give to each retailer you shop with. The company will then keep your purchases locally until they are ready to be shipped to you. This is a great option for people who are moving to the UK or for those who do not have a close family member or friend in the country.
